- Ensure all areas are cleaned efficiently and in a timely manner to the required standards - this to include weekly and periodic tasks
- Use cleaning chemicals safely as detailed by the Control of Substances Hazardous to health guidelines (COSHH)
- Ensure full working knowledge of all cleaning equipment, materials and agents and use cleaning equipment as directed by the Line Manager only after correct training is given.
- Report immediately any equipment which is faulty, mark as faulty and do not use
- Ensure that the safety signage is used appropriate at all times, e.g. wet floor signs and 'warn' customers where possible
- Ensure that cleaning stores are kept clean and tidy and equipment is stored correctly and safely at all times
